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 15 mins
Total Time: 25 mins
Cuisine: Thai
Serves: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 1 can coconut milk
  2. 2 cups vegetable broth
  3. 1 tablespoon red curry paste
  4. 1 cup mushrooms, sliced
  5. 1 cup bell pepper, sliced
  6. 1 tablespoon lime juice
  7. Fresh cilantro for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are all ingredients by washing and slicing mushrooms and bell peppers into thin, uniform pieces.
  2. Turn on the Instant Pot and select the "Sauté" function. Add a small amount of oil and heat for 1 minute.
  3. Add red curry paste to the pot and stir quickly, cooking for 30 seconds to release its aromatic flavors.
  4. Pour in coconut milk and vegetable broth, whisking to combine the curry paste thoroughly with the liquid.
  5. Add sliced mushrooms and bell peppers to the liquid mixture, stirring gently to distribute evenly.
  6. Close the Instant Pot lid, set the valve to sealing position, and select "Manual" or "Pressure Cook" mode.
  7. Cook on high pressure for 5 minutes, then perform a quick release of pressure after cooking completes.
  8. Open the lid and stir in fresh lime juice, which will brighten the soup's overall flavor profile.
  9.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ed, adding salt or additional curry paste to preference.
  10. Ladle soup into serving bowls and garnish generously with fresh chopped cilantro.
  11. Serve hot, optionally with steamed rice or additional lime wedges on the side.

Tips

  1. Spice Level Control: Adjust the red curry paste quantity to match your heat tolerance. Start with less and add more gradually.
  2. Vegetable Variations: Feel free to swap or add vegetables like tofu, carrots, or spinach to customize your soup.
  3. Instant Pot Precision: Ensure your Instant Pot valve is correctly set to "sealing" for proper pressure cooking.
  4. Fresh is Best: Use fresh lime juice and cilantro for maximum flavor brightness.
  5. Serving Suggestions: Pair with jasmine rice or add protein like shredded chicken for a more substantial meal.
  6. Make-Ahead Friendly: This soup tastes even better the next day, so don't hesitate to make it in advance.
